Role Overview & Responsibilities

Monday - Friday / 13:00 - 21:00

Key responsibilities:

· Administrator of our team of drivers and distribution staff.

· Monitoring time sheets and reporting any issues.

· Scheduling and managing planned maintenance of fleet through agreed providers.

· Assist in route planning using E-proof of delivery software

· Delivery input into external 3PL providers such as TNT and Fedex.

· Brief all drivers on policies and procedures.

· Co-Ordinate all delivery orders through our software system.

· Debrief all delivery drivers, collate all manifests and upload into Software.

· Ensure effective communication throughout the Company.

· Identify opportunities to further improve efficiency and effectiveness.

· Contribute to the resolution of client queries and delivery disputes.

· To promote Company Standards in all situations.

· To deliver services effectively, a degree of flexibility is needed, and the post holder may be required to perform work not specifically referred to above.

· To carry out any other reasonable duties as required by the company.

· Polite customer service telephone manners.

The role has the following Principal Relationships:

· Accountable to- Transport & Distribution Manager

· Responsible for all admin duties in goods out, Stock assistance and delivery fleet.

· External- Maintains external contacts as necessary to fulfil 100% service levels.

The following are the Essential and Desirable Skills and Qualifications:

Essential

· Management experience of people, time and money

· Previous experience working with telematics and tracking software

· Desired knowledge and experience of all transport and driver regulations

· Experience of working with third party driving agencies, ideally combined with some knowledge of agency workers.

· Excellent communication skills

· Strong organisational skills with the ability to prioritise workload to meet conflicting, frequently demanding, deadlines

· Proficient in the use of MS Office including intermediate MS PowerPoint, and Excel skills for data analysis and presentation in order to influence business cases e.g. pivot tables, graphs etc.

· Knowledge of Health & Safety requirements

Desirable:

  • IOSH or NEBOSH
